TUSCALOOSA, Ala. – Alabama junior linebacker Rolando McClain announced Monday that he would enter the 2010 NFL Draft. The Butkus Award winner was a 2009 team captain and led the Crimson Tide in total tackles in each of the last two seasons.

McClain was a unanimous first-team All-American this season and started at linebacker for Alabama the last three years. The Decatur, Ala. native is just the second Crimson Tide player to win the Butkus Award, joining Derrick Thomas (1988).

Quote from Head Coach Nick Saban
“Rolando McClain has been as great an ambassador for the University of Alabama probably as anyone ever has in terms of how he’s represented himself, his family, the university, the state of Alabama and our team. That’s not only in terms of being a great football player – probably the best defensive football player in the country, in my opinion, or one of them, and certainly at his position – but he always did things right. He’s done a great job academically. His leadership had as much impact on our team and our team’s success since he’s been here in the last three years – even in his freshman year – as anyone that I’ve ever been associated with. And we appreciate that.
